On August 21, 2025, SourceUp and the Tropical Forest Alliance (TFA) co-hosted a panel discussion that explored how companies can take their first steps into landscape and jurisdictional initiatives (LJIs). This event brought together experts from CDP, Sainsbury’s, SourceUp, and the Tropical Forest Alliance to discuss the benefits, challenges, and practical pathways for companies investing in LJIs. In this Landscapes Lab session speakers highlighted key findings from two critical studies based on the recent LandScale assessment for the Alto Mayo landscape in San Martin, Peru. First, a validated Roadmap for Alto Mayo which was co-developed with public and private stakeholders, highlighting opportunities for landscape collaboration on sustainability challenges. This webinar was focused on two collective position papers, that have been developed under the facilitation of ISEAL that provide baseline guidance for companies on good practices for making claims about landscape actions and outcomes, and the responsibilities companies have for supporting landscape monitoring.

The new Causality Assessment for Landscape Interventions (CALI) Guidebook provides a practical methodology for ongoing sensemaking and adaptation for project teams and oversight to ensure effective and optimal implementation of project resources aimed to reduce deforestation in landscapes.
